1.) Understanding "Seen" Notifications:




The “seen” notification is a feature designed to let users know when their message has been read by the recipient. This might seem like a straightforward function, but its implications can be profound when considered from a psychological perspective.

1. Awareness of Presence: When you see that someone has seen your message, it creates a sense of awareness about your presence in their digital space. This can influence how people perceive and value the communication channel-it might feel more urgent or important if they know you’re paying attention to the messages.

2. Expectations Management: Seeing “seen” notifications can alter expectations about immediate response times, which might make users adjust their own behavior regarding timing of replies. If someone expects a quick reply because you have seen their message, they might be more likely to respond immediately or at least within expected norms.

3. Psychological Impact on Interaction: The presence of “seen” notifications can subtly influence the psychology of interaction. Users may feel less free to express personal thoughts or emote emotionally if they know someone is monitoring their words-a form of digital scrutiny that can impact honesty and openness in communication.




2.) Analyzing "Typing" Notifications:




The appearance of a “typing” indicator on the other hand, while seemingly innocuous, can have significant implications as well:

1. Maintaining Engagement: The continuous presence of a typing indicator can be an unconscious attempt to maintain engagement with the conversation. Users might feel compelled to keep typing in order to justify their continued presence and relevance within the chat-even if they don’t have anything substantial to contribute at that moment.

2. Preserving Connection: This feature is often used subconsciously to preserve a sense of connection or involvement in ongoing conversations, even when there isn't much activity. It’s akin to how people might continue small talk to keep a social interaction going-a similar pattern can be observed with typing notifications.

3. Understanding Interest Levels: The presence of the “typing” indicator gives others insights into your interest level or engagement in the conversation. If someone is seeing frequent typing notifications, it could indicate either high interest or difficulty keeping up with the chat, which might influence how people respond to such interactions.
